苹果重复使用的证书签名请求推送服务

问题描述:

企业社会责任的建立将促使 钥匙串访问同时 生成公钥和私钥 对。您的私人密钥存储在 您的Mac中日....苹果重复使用的证书签名请求推送服务

所以每次iOS应用可以有两种环境设置了推送通知,开发和生产。

dev和prod环境中重复使用相同的CSR(以及相同的私钥)有什么危害?这甚至有可能吗?

类似的效果在不同的应用程序中使用相同的CSR会带来什么样的危害。

基本上我想管理一个单独的私钥,当我将要处理的推送通知在我的一端的服务器上安装所需的元素。

感谢

我用我所有证书相同的私有/公共密钥。唯一一次我拥有不同的私钥/公钥时,客户希望我管理他们的整个Apple账户和证书生成。

+0

很高兴知道谢谢!尽管看起来苹果并不真的希望我们这样做,从他们的CSR/SSL/Provisioning演练:“为了开发和部署客户端/服务器应用程序的提供者端,您必须从iPhone Provisioning Portal获得SSL证书。每个证书仅限于一个应用程序,由其捆绑ID标识。每个证书也仅限于两种开发环境之一 – Joey 2011-05-11 22:06:18